What is a .VFS0 file?

Game file used by Metro 2033 and Metro: Last Light, a post-apocalyptic video game that takes place in Moscow; contains .OGG sound files used by the game for music and sound effects.

Additional Information

  • File type: Metro 2033 Sound File

  • File extension: .VFS0

  • Developer: 4A Games

  • Category: Game Files

  • Format: N/A
